Williams F1 confirm sale to Dorilton Capital

Williams F1 have confirmed the team have been purchased by American private investment company Dorilton Capital. It was announced in May that Williams were considering a partial or full sale of the iconic team to ease financial pressures and undergoing a strategic review of the best way to protect its future. The team had suffered a downturn in revenues in recent years after finishing bottom of the F1 constructors' World Championship in each of the last two seasons. In a statement, Williams confirmed the team had been bought out by Dorilton Capital in a move that brings “a successful conclusion to the Strategic Review which was launched in late May'.
